Miners feature prominently among the top performers, helped by bullish comment from Royal Bank of Scotland (RBS). RBS has upgraded Antofagasta from 'sell' to 'buy'. RBS reiterated its 'hold' rating for Eurasian Natural Resources but has raised its price target from 670p to 850p.Royal Bank of Scotland itself is higher despite a report it will finalise a £4bn share placing this week. The cash raised will reduce the cost of entry to the Asset Protection Scheme. Elsewhere in the banking sector Barclays is upgraded by UBS to 'neutral' from 'sell'.Life insurer Aviva is the heaviest faller in the FTSE 100 after it confirmed it is to sell a minority stake in its Dutch insurance business Delta Lloyd through a float on Euronext in Amsterdam.
